To remove the battery from a Yamaha Royal Star 1300, first, ensure the motorcycle is turned off and parked on a stable surface. Locate the battery compartment, typically under the seat or side panel. Remove the seat or panel by unscrewing any fasteners, then disconnect the negative (-) terminal first followed by the positive (+) terminal. Finally, lift the battery out of its compartment carefully.
The alternator of the Yamaha V Star 1100 Classic motorcycle is located on the left side of the engine, behind the left crankcase cover. It is part of the charging system and is driven by the engine's crankshaft. Accessing it typically requires removing the left side cover and possibly other components for maintenance or replacement.

The main fuse for a 2005 Yamaha V Star 650 Classic motorcycle is located under the seat. To access it, you need to remove the seat by unscrewing the bolts or releasing the latches. Once the seat is off, the fuse box is typically found near the battery, covered by a plastic cover. Always refer to the owner's manual for specific details and diagrams.
On a 2000 Yamaha V Star, the positive terminal on the starter relay switch is typically marked with a "+" sign or is colored red. This terminal connects to the battery's positive lead. Always ensure the motorcycle is off and properly grounded before working on electrical components to avoid any accidents.
